Furthermore, the attention economy dictates that platforms compete not for money first, but for time . Algorithms on YouTube, TikTok, and Facebook are optimized to maximize watch time, often pushing sensational, polarizing, or emotionally charged content to the top. This has profound implications for society, as entertainment bleeds into news, and news adopts the pacing of entertainment.
